Emo grocery store broken into

News Release
OPP

The Rainy River District Detachment of the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) is currently investigating a Break and Enter occurring at a local grocery store in Emo, ON. On March 10, 2014 at approximately 12:33 am, a male suspect was observed leaving the area of the store and fled when approached by a witness.
The suspect is described as a younger male, approximately 5’8” tall, medium build, red hoodie sweater, dark grey feather down jacket with a horizontal white line across chest and shoulders, dark pants, dark shoes and wearing a black balaclava.
Fort Frances Canine Unit assisted in the police response. Police are continuing their investigation. Anyone with information pertaining to this crime is urged to contact the OPP at 1-888-310-1122 or Crime Stoppers at 1-800-222-8477 (TIPS).
